What Are Authority Links?
Authority links are essentially white-hat backlinks that come from trusted and reputable sources.
These links are often found on high-quality websites with relevant content, which is why they're so valuable for building authority and credibility online.
Using white-hat tactics ensures your domain remains in good standing with search engines like Google, which is crucial for maintaining a strong online presence.
White-hat link-building strategies are relatively low risk, meaning you're less likely to lose website traffic due to a penalty.
White-hat SEO tactics may take longer to pay off, but their value is more stable, making them a worthwhile investment in the long run.
A white-hat backlink is a hyperlink on a trustworthy domain on a page with relevant content, which is exactly what you're aiming for with authority link building.

How to Build Authority Links
Building authority links is a crucial step in establishing your online presence, and it's not just about asking for links. You can earn them by producing valuable content that others naturally reference. This is known as content marketing.
You might like: Content Farm Examples
To get started, you need to identify trending topics or gaps in your niche, and then produce in-depth, high-quality content that addresses those topics. This can be in the form of blog posts, infographics, or other types of content that are shareable and valuable to your audience.
You can also use tools like Buzzsumo or Ahrefs Content Explorer to find popular content in your niche and create even better content on the same topic. This is known as the Skyscraper Technique, which involves reaching out to other websites linking to the original content and suggesting they link to yours instead.
There are three main ways to build backlinks: you can add them, ask for them, or earn them. To earn them, you need to build mutual relationships with trusted publishers by researching their content and finding opportunities to respectfully reach out.
Here are the main link building techniques to keep in mind:
- Add backlinks by including outbound links in your own content that point to other high-quality sources.
- Ask for backlinks by reaching out to other websites and suggesting they link to your content.
- Earn backlinks by producing valuable content that others naturally reference.
By focusing on earning backlinks through content marketing and building mutual relationships with trusted publishers, you can increase your site's authority and drive more traffic to your site.

Link Explorer, a tool offered by Moz, is a game-changer for link building strategies. It analyzes any page you choose and reports on backlinks, competitors, broken links, anchor texts, and link building opportunities.
This tool is free to use, with more comprehensive data available in the Pro version starting at $99/month. Moz is also responsible for the Domain Authority and Page Authority indicators.
You can access the reports presented by Link Explorer through MozBar, a free extension for Chrome and Firefox. It shows this data directly on the SERP or when accessing sites.
Finding broken links on other sites can be a quick win-win for both you and the site owner, and Link Explorer can help you do just that.

Quality of Authority Links
When building high authority backlinks, it's essential to prioritize quality over quantity. Focus on earning a few high-quality links from authoritative sites rather than chasing large quantities of low-quality links.
High-quality links come from highly reputed, influential websites, carrying significant amounts of "link juice". This means they're more valuable than regular backlinks from less influential sources.
To create link-worthy content, invest in producing valuable, unique content like case studies, in-depth guides, or infographics that naturally attract backlinks. This type of content is more likely to be shared and linked to than low-quality or plagiarized content.
Avoid buying links from unauthoritative sources, as it can harm your website's credibility and ranking. Instead, consider partnering with a reputable agency for your link-building strategy.
Here are some common mistakes to avoid when building high-quality links:
- Buying links from unauthoritative sources
- Participating in link schemes like reciprocal linking or excessive link exchanges
- Overusing exact match keywords in anchor text
- Getting backlinks from low-quality or spammy websites
- Creating low-quality or plagiarized content
By following these best practices, you can increase your chances of getting high-quality links that will improve your website's credibility and ranking.

Guest Posting & Co-Marketing
Guest posting is a widely used practice to get high-authority backlinks. It's one of the most effective methods, and when done correctly, it can help you receive high DA backlinks for your site.
To get high-authority links through guest posting, you need to create top-quality content that will make high-authority sites believe in your writing. This is where professional guest blogging services providers come in, like Outreach Monks, who can help you create incredibly top-quality content.
Expand your knowledge: Top Link Building Agencies
Many partnerships are created just to generate backlinks without thinking about the user experience. This strategy doesn't work and can even get you penalized by Google. Instead, choose partners that have a similar audience to yours, so that you attract visitors who will be interested in your content.
Guest posting consists of creating content as a guest author on a blog. You produce a post that is relevant to your partner's blog, and in return, they allow you to insert one or more links to your pages. This way, your partner transmits part of their authority to you, and your website attracts more visitors.
Co-marketing is another strategy that involves companies coming together to create materials in partnership, such as ebooks or tools. Both partners promote the product and link to each other's pages, which can help you get high-authority backlinks.

Context
Context is key in digital marketing. Google can understand the context around a link to gauge its relevance.
To increase the value of a link, it's essential to relate to the same field as the target site. This makes the link more likely to be relevant to the site's audience.
Google evaluates the words that appear around the link, known as co-occurrences. These words help the search engine understand the page's topic and whether the link makes sense within the context.
The position of links also counts. Links found in the main content on the page are valued more than those in the header or footer.
Here are some ways to optimize link context:
- Use relevant words around the link
- Place links in the main content, especially at the beginning of a text
- Avoid using too many links, as this can dilute the value of each link
By considering context, you can increase the value of your links and improve your digital marketing efforts.
Content Marketing
Content marketing is a crucial aspect of digital marketing that can help you earn high-quality backlinks to your site. Creating linkable digital marketing assets is a great way to start, and some examples include infographics, interactive content, posts with lists, complete guides, and research results.
To increase the chance of sharing, invest in creating high-quality content that is easy to understand, engaging, or brings new and original data.
Here are some examples of linkable assets that you can produce:
- Infographics
- Interactive content, such as quizzes, calculators, and assessments
- Posts with lists
- Complete guides
- Research results you’ve found
Great content supports your link building strategy by earning quality links for you. Focus on creating high-value posts that people can’t help but mention and share with their own followings.
Posts with value aim to answer questions members of your audience may have but might not think to ask. They help people make decisions, deep-dive into key industry trends, and address popular topics from fresh, exciting, new angles.
